STAIND Announce Massive 2026 Headlining Tour Celebrating 25 Years Of Break The Cycle

Date:


Staind are gearing up for a major victory lap. The multi-platinum rock band have announced a huge 2026 headlining tour celebrating the 25th anniversary of their landmark album Break the Cycle (the album with “It’s Been Awhile”, “Fade”, “Outside”, and “For You”) — a record that helped define early-2000s alternative rock and launched the band into arena-level success.

Kicking off this May and running through the fall, the tour will see Staind joined by a stacked lineup of modern rock heavyweights, with Seether, Hoobastank, and Hinder set to rotate as support across the run. Get your tickets here.

“2026 is gonna be BIG!” the band shared alongside the announcement. “We’re celebrating 25 years of Break The Cycle with a 2026 tour starting this May and going through the fall!”
